Wisconsin AG files suit against drug makers over wholesale pricing
Chris Buell at 2:28 PM ET

Wisconsin Attorney General Peg Lautenschlager filed suit today against 20 drug manufacturers alleging that the companies inflated prices and violated state wholesale pricing laws beginning in 1992. The suit seeks to force the manufactuers, which include Pfizer, Johnson & Johnson and Bayer Corp., to set up a restitution program for state residents and health programs. Attorneys general in 13 other states have already filed similar pricing suits which are still pending. The Wisconsin Department of Justice offers a press release. AP has more.
